Nara Hotel
9.3/5357 Reviews
A hotel full of history as it has been the chosen venue for important events in Nara. Many celebrities had stayed in this hotel including Albert Einstein. Tried the rice lager at the tea house which is very good tgough some may find it not strong enough. The vicinity is nice. It is within waljing distance of the famous Nara Park. The room is spacious. Shuttle bus service to Nara station is excellent. Very helpful staff. An enjoyable stay indeed!

Henn na Hotel Nara
9.2/5434 Reviews
The hotel had no staff, a dinosaur or an anime character will speak to you for check in and check out..haha. You just scan your passport and enter some basic information, then you can get the room key. The room size is great for 2 people and all suitcases could be fully opened. If you want to store your luggage after check out, also need to press and pay at the store luggage machine by yourself. That was good for teenagers or adults for staying. If elderly, which not familiar for electric device, not recommend for staying.
